AFRICAN SOCIAL INNOVATION FELLOWSHIP

Application Deadline: 4 August, 2024

LOCATION: Multiple Regions

DO Take Action and DEAL Capital are excited to announce the launch of the African Social Innovation Fellowship (ASIF), a transformative opportunity for young leaders across Sub-Saharan Africa. This fellowship program equips fellows with the knowledge, opportunities, resources, and network needed to lead a successful career, access opportunities, become a global leader in their field, and most importantly, shape the future of their community, country, Africa, and the world.

ELIGIBILITY:

You are a leader or interested in becoming a Leader. You want to be a force for good and change in your Community or Nation.

Your want to Improve your economic condition, access local and global job or internship opportunities or want to build a stable career.

You have a desire to become an influential figure and a powerful force in your industry or sector in the near future.

You want to access and leverage local and global opportunities and networks such as Scholarships, conferences etc.

BENEFIT:

Project Funding: Selected fellows will have access to funding opportunities to support their community projects or social enterprises.

Global Exposure: Opportunities for international travel and participation in conferences and events.

Networking Opportunities: Connect with a diverse network of global leaders and changemakers committed to social and economic development in Africa and the African Diaspora.

Mentorship and Support: Receive personalized coaching and mentorship from experienced leaders, renowned personalities, and distinguished change agents from both Africa and the diaspora.

Comprehensive Training: Access to professional development and leadership training tailored to foster personal growth and career enhancement.

WIJHAT GRANT PROGRAM FOR ARTIST OF ALL ARTISTIC DISCIPLINE

Application Deadline: September 17, 2024

LOCATION: Arab

Artists of all artistic disciplines (performing arts, visual arts, literature, music, etc.), Cultural actors (working independently or members/staff of cultural initiatives/organizations), Individuals or groups are invited to apply for Culture Resources Wijhat Grants.

ELIGIBILITY:

Eligible country: From a country in the Arab region to another country in the Arab region, or From a country outside the Arab region to a country in the Arab region, or From a country in the Arab region to a country outside this region

Applicants must be from an Arab country
(regardless of ethnic affiliation and citizenship status). They may reside in the Arab region or abroad.

The country of departure or arrival for an intended travel must be in the Arab region.
The grant is available for individuals as well as for groups (bands, folk troupes, associations, work teams, theatre/dance companies, etc — see the section on applying as a group).

The grant targets:
Artists of all disciplines: live arts, visual arts, literature, music, etc.
Cultural actors, whether working independently or as members or staff of cultural initiatives or organizations.
Examples of potential grantees: playwrights and theater directors, musicians, creative writers, cultural managers, cultural researchers, curators, etc.

The host may not apply on behalf of the invitee. Every artist/group must submit their own application along with the required supporting documents. The host may help an artist/group fill out the application. However, the form itself must be completed by the artist/group, express their point of view and be submitted by them as well.

Applications from individuals under 18 years old will be accepted on the condition that the application is accompanied by a written letter of consent from a parent or guardian.

Recipients of a Wijhat grant may not apply again for the mobility grant until at least 16 months (the equivalent of four rounds) have passed since receiving a grant. This period is calculated from the date on which that grant was announced.

Recipients of any other type of grant from Culture Resource (apart from another mobility grant) may still apply for a grant from the Wijhat program.

BENEFIT:

Up to €7,000 to cover: 

Travel tickets

Visa costs

Accommodation

Partial coverage of living expenses

Internal transportation
